API
~~~
The backend renders :class:`pybtex.richtext.Text` instances
into a list of :class:`docutils.nodes.Text`
and :class:`docutils.nodes.inline` instances (or subclasses of these).
For typical use cases, all you need to care about are the methods
:meth:`Backend.paragraph`,
:meth:`Backend.citation`, and
:meth:`Backend.citation_reference`
which are to be called on *formatted* entries,
as in the :ref:`minimal example <minimal-example>`.
Note that you should not import the :mod:`pybtex_docutils` module directly.
Instead, use pybtex's plugin system to get the :class:`Backend` class,
again,
as in the :ref:`minimal example <minimal-example>`.

import docutils.nodes
import itertools
from pybtex.backends import BaseBackend
import pybtex.richtext
import six
[docs]class Backend(BaseBackend):
name = 'docutils'
symbols = {
'ndash': [docutils.nodes.Text('\u2013', '\u2013')],
'newblock': [docutils.nodes.Text(' ', ' ')],
'nbsp': [docutils.nodes.Text('\u00a0', '\u00a0')],
}
tags = {
'emph': docutils.nodes.emphasis, # note: deprecated
'em': docutils.nodes.emphasis,
'strong': docutils.nodes.strong,
'i': docutils.nodes.emphasis,
'b': docutils.nodes.strong,
'tt': docutils.nodes.literal,
}
RenderType = list
# for compatibility only
def format_text(self, text):
return self.format_str(text)
def format_str(self, str_):
assert isinstance(str_, six.string_types)
return [docutils.nodes.Text(str_, str_)]
def format_tag(self, tag_name, text):
assert isinstance(tag_name, six.string_types)
assert isinstance(text, self.RenderType)
if tag_name in self.tags:
tag = self.tags[tag_name]
return [tag('', '', *text)]
else:
return text
def format_href(self, url, text):
assert isinstance(url, six.string_types)
assert isinstance(text, self.RenderType)
node = docutils.nodes.reference('', '', *text, refuri=url)
return [node]
def write_entry(self, key, label, text):
raise NotImplementedError("use Backend.citation() instead")
def render_sequence(self, rendered_list):
return list(itertools.chain(*rendered_list))
[docs] def paragraph(self, entry):
"""Return a docutils.nodes.paragraph
containing the rendered text for *entry* (without label).
.. versionadded:: 0.2.0
"""
return docutils.nodes.paragraph('', '', *entry.text.render(self))
[docs] def citation(self, entry, document, use_key_as_label=True):
"""Return citation node, with key as name, label as first
child, and paragraph with entry text as second child. The citation is
expected to be inserted into *document* prior to any docutils
transforms.
"""
# see docutils.parsers.rst.states.Body.citation()
if use_key_as_label:
label = entry.key
else:
label = entry.label
name = docutils.nodes.fully_normalize_name(entry.key)
text = entry.text.render(self)
citation = docutils.nodes.citation()
citation['names'].append(name)
citation += docutils.nodes.label('', label)
citation += self.paragraph(entry)
document.note_citation(citation)
document.note_explicit_target(citation, citation)
return citation
[docs] def citation_reference(self, entry, document, use_key_as_label=True):
"""Return citation_reference node to the given citation. The
citation_reference is expected to be inserted into *document*
prior to any docutils transforms.
"""
# see docutils.parsers.rst.states.Body.footnote_reference()
if use_key_as_label:
label = entry.key
else:
label = entry.label
refname = docutils.nodes.fully_normalize_name(entry.key)
refnode = docutils.nodes.citation_reference(
'[%s]_' % label, refname=refname)
refnode += docutils.nodes.Text(label)
document.note_citation_ref(refnode)
return refnode
def footnote(self, entry, document):
"""Return footnote node, with key as name, and paragraph with
entry text as child. The footnote is expected to be
inserted into *document* prior to any docutils transforms.
"""
# see docutils.parsers.rst.states.Body.footnote()
name = docutils.nodes.fully_normalize_name(entry.key)
footnote = docutils.nodes.footnote(auto=1)
footnote['names'].append(name)
footnote += self.paragraph(entry)
document.note_autofootnote(footnote)
document.note_explicit_target(footnote, footnote)
return footnote
def footnote_reference(self, entry, document):
"""Return footnote_reference node to the given citation. The
footnote_reference is expected to be inserted into *document*
prior to any docutils transforms.
"""
# see docutils.parsers.rst.states.Body.footnote_reference()
refname = docutils.nodes.fully_normalize_name(entry.key)
refnode = docutils.nodes.footnote_reference(
'[#%s]_' % entry.key, refname=refname, auto=1)
document.note_autofootnote_ref(refnode)
document.note_footnote_ref(refnode)
return refnode
